Folder setup

Ignore this if you know how you like to organize things.

Before you start downloading things and creating projects, it's a good idea to figure out where new things will all go. I personally put code and project information in ~/Documents/code, applications in ~/Applications, and SDKs in /Developer/SDKs.

Organization is all preference, but it'll make your life easier to pick specific spots for things and always put those types of things in those specific spots. Software installed by package managers usually install to the right place, so you don't have to worry about it.

Profile file

Create a file in /Users/your-user-name, aka ~, called ".profile" where you'll save environment variables for programs and update the path variable.

Note: to check if the file is there, list the files with hidden files shown:

$ ls -a ~

and you should see '.profile' in the list of files. To open .profile in TextWrangler, use:

$ edit ~/.profile

System-wide $PATH

The $PATH environment variable is a list of colon-separated paths where the shell looks for to find program names. The default order for all users on the machine is in /etc/paths. Open it up, and change the order to be compatible with package managers:

$ edit /etc/paths

And in /etc/paths (newline at the end is important) (order is also important):

/usr/local/bin
/usr/local/sbin
/usr/bin
/bin
/usr/sbin
/sbin

To add more paths, make a /etc/paths.d/ folder and put more path files there. Again, this is system-wide. To add paths just for a specific user, you can append to the $PATH variable in "~/.profile" like so:

# add /new/path/to/add to path
export PATH=/new/path/to/add:$PATH

Homebrew

Homebrew is an incredibly easy to use and transparent package manager for OSX. "Homebrew installs the stuff you need that Apple didn’t."

To install it, paste this command into Terminal:

$ ruby -e "$(curl -fsSkL raw.github.com/mxcl/homebrew/go)"

You'll see after the install that you need Xcode, so I hope you installed it. If not, install Xcode and come back. Run the following command to get Homebrew ready to use.

$ brew doctor

Node.js and Node Package Manager

Regardless if you use node.js or not, more and more software is relying on the server-side V8 JavaScript implementation and npm, or Node Package Manager. I'll give two ways to install them, the first with Homebrew:

$ brew install node

Unfortunately npm does not come with the homebrew installation anymore, so you'll have to get npm independently.

$ curl http://npmjs.org/install.sh | sh

Or you can go to the node.js website and choose the installer for your platform. If you install it this way, you need to claim ownership of the folder it installs to, or Homebrew may have issues writing header files. So run the following command:

$ sudo chown -R `whoami` /usr/local/include

Either way once you have node and npm installed, you need to follow up with adding paths to your .profile file. These are basically environment variables that are set at each login.

$ edit ~/.profile

Add the following lines and save .profile

export NODE_PATH=/usr/local/lib/node
export PATH=/usr/local/share/npm/bin:$PATH

Afterwards, close and reopen all command prompts.

Python

Mac computers come with python, but I wanted the lastest version. So install python's dependencies and then python with Homebrew. Note that if you aren't the owner of /usr/local be sure to claim ownership.

$ sudo chown -R `whoami` /usr/local

Then install python and its dependencies with Homebrew

$ brew install readline sqlite gdbm
$ brew install python --universal --framework

It'll take a while. Then we need to edit the .profile again to add the new python location to the PATH variable so the Homebrew version of python is used instead of the system version.

# ~/.profile

PATH=/usr/local/share/python:$PATH

Now you should be have the latest stable release of python. Also, most python development relies on the Python Package Index, so install that too:

$ easy_install pip

Ruby

Mac computers also come with ruby, but not the latest version. Use Hombrew to install it:

$ brew install ruby

It takes a while. Then update your path in the profile file. Check which ruby version Homebrew installed, I got "1.9.3-p194". Then add it to your path:

# ~/.profile

PATH=/usr/local/Cellar/ruby/1.9.3-p194/bin:$PATH

Rails

I don't use the built-in documentation ever, so to save gem installation time I don't install them. To set permanent flags to the bundle commands, make a file ~/.gemrc and add these lines:

install: --no-rdoc --no-ri
update:  --no-rdoc --no-ri

Then install rails:

$ gem install rails
